Other Information

Troubleshooting

If you are having a problem with your TV, try the suggestions below. If the problem persists,
contact your nearest Sony Dealer.

No picture, no
sound



Make sure the power cord is plugged in.



If a red light is flashing on the front of your TV for more than a
few minutes, disconnect and reconnect the power cord to restore
the TV. If the problem continues, call your local service center.



Check the TV/VIDEO settings: when watching TV, set to TV;
when watching video equipment, set to VIDEO (page 13).



Make sure the batteries have been inserted correctly into the
remote control (page 2).



Try another channel; it could be station trouble.

Poor or no picture,
good sound



Adjust Picture in the Picture Controls menu under Video
(page 18).



Adjust Brightness in the Picture Controls menu under Video
(page 18).



Check the antenna and/or cable connections (page 4).

Good picture, no
sound



Press

so that MUTING disappears from the screen (page 13).



Check your Audio settings. Your TV may be set to Auto SAP
(page 19).

No color



Adjust Color in the Picture Controls menu under Video (page 18).

Only snow appears
on the screen



Check the Cable setting in the Channel Setup menu (page 20).



Check the antenna and/or cable connections (page 4).



Make sure the channel selected is currently broadcasting.

Dotted lines or
stripes



Adjust the antenna.



Move the TV away from other electronic equipment. Some
electronic equipment can create electrical noise, which can
interfere with TV reception.

Double images or
ghosts



Check your outdoor antenna or call your cable service.
